Proper Names for Garage Door

1. Main Garage Door

The standard and most widely recognized name.

2. Sectional Door

A proper term for panel-based garage doors.

3. Roll-Up Door

Used for doors that coil upward into a roll.

4. Overhead Door

A formal name for doors that lift above.

5. Sliding Garage Door

For doors that move sideways instead of up.

6. Tilt-Up Door

A professional name for one-piece doors that tilt open.

7. Retractable Garage Door

Common in modern homes with automated systems.

8. Canopy Garage Door

A proper name for doors that extend outward like a canopy.

9. Folding Garage Door

Refers to bi-fold or multi-fold garage door types.

10. Automatic Garage Door

The formal term for motorized versions.

11. Carriage House Door

A traditional name with a classic touch.

12. Insulated Garage Door

Used when highlighting energy efficiency.
